What Are Carbon Credits?

At its essence, a carbon credit is a exchangeable certificate representing the right to emit one metric ton of carbon dioxide (CO2) or its equivalent in various greenhouse gases (GHGs), such as nitrous oxide. Carbon credits are a pillar of carbon markets, which are structured to incentivize businesses to cut their carbon impact.

The idea operates on a straightforward principle: those who emit less than their allocated amount of GHGs can sell their excess credits to companies that overshoot their emissions limits. This creates a monetary incentive for reducing emissions while offering flexibility for businesses that face hurdles in slashing their emissions right away. Carbon credits are often issued under formal frameworks like the UN mechanisms or non-mandatory schemes like the Gold Standard.

How Do Carbon Credits Work?

Carbon credits perform within two primary markets: official markets and non-regulated markets.

Official Markets

Regulated markets are governed by regulatory bodies. For instance, under the European Union’s Emissions Trading System (EU ETS), firms in carbon-intensive sectors (for example cement) are given a limit on their GHG emissions. If a company emits less than its quota, it can sell its unused credits to other company that has gone over its limit. This system promotes that aggregate emissions stay within a designated limit while fostering progress in sustainable technologies.

Voluntary Markets

Non-mandatory carbon markets permit organizations to buy carbon credits to counterbalance their emissions voluntarily. For instance, a company might buy credits to counter the emissions from its business travel. These credits frequently fund projects like renewable energy in underserved countries.

The mechanism of generating carbon credits usually involves a effort that avoids emissions. For example, a methane capture initiative that replaces landfill emissions can create credits. These efforts are rigorously verified by certified organizations to guarantee their carbon credibility before credits are released.

Hurdles and Concerns

In spite of their value, carbon credits are not without hurdles. Observers point out that the mechanism has weaknesses that can undermine its success.

Integrity and Auditing

One primary concern is “genuine impact”—whether a initiative funded by carbon credits would have been implemented without support without the economic support. For instance, if a wind farm was already intended, crediting it for emissions reductions may not generate real climate results. Strict validation methods are critical to ensure that initiatives deliver tangible, measurable mitigation.

Possibility of Deceptive Practices

Some firms use carbon credits as a way to appear climate friendly without committing to real shifts to their processes. This practice, known as misrepresentation, can damage public faith in carbon markets. To address this, accountability and responsibility are vital, with strict protocols for what constitutes a reliable carbon credit.

Market Fluctuations

The value of carbon credits can change based on economic conditions. In some instances, reduced prices may undermine the benefit for firms to commit in sustainable practices. Building consistent and predictable market approaches is key for the long-term success of carbon markets.

The Horizon of Carbon Credits

As the globe endeavors to achieve the targets of the UN climate goals, carbon credits are poised to play an progressively essential role. Nations are enhancing mandatory markets, with economies like China introducing their own emissions trading systems. Simultaneously, optional markets are rising steadily, driven by corporate commitments to carbon neutrality and public expectation for eco-friendly models.

Technological developments are also enhancing the credibility of carbon credits. Digital ledger technology, for instance, is being implemented to establish open, unalterable ledgers of carbon exchanges. In addition, innovations in carbon capture and storage (CCS) are creating novel pathways for producing credits by actively sequestering CO2 from the environment.
